    I live somewhat near Miami, however I have only shot inside the city a couple of times so I don't have to much to offer. Most of the places outside of the city I go are for wildlife and all at least an hours drive (if youre willing to go that far I can give you a list of places though). Within the city if you go over the bridge to key Biscayne there are good places to get nice city scape shots. There is also an abandoned amphitheater there as well which is fun to shoot.

    This was taken about 45-60 min south of Miami in the heat and humidity of June.
    Charles Deering Estate. Just south of Miami, Florida
    On a fine Sunday afternoon, I found myself at the edge of the Atlantic Ocean at this great site. The fast moving clouds and overhead sun called for some long exposure imaging.
    7D | 10-22mm @ 13mm | f/22 | 58 sec exposure | ISO 100 | LEE Big Stopper | LEE 2 stop soft GND
